石墨炉原子吸收光谱法测定工业用重质碳酸钙铅含量

摘  要:建立石墨炉原子吸收光谱法测定工业用重质碳酸钙铅含量的方法。通过对标准曲线、回收率、精密度、检出限等技术指标进行检测方法验证,结果表明标准曲线线性关系良好,相关系数大于0.99,加标回收率为90%~100.5%,精密度RSD在1.2%~6.7%之间,检出限为0.2 mg/kg,结果均符合要求,表明了方法的可行性。具体阐述新项目建立时如何进行该项目方法验证,具有较强实用性和指导性。Establish a method for determining the content of heavy calcium carbonate and lead in industrial use using graphite furnace atomic absorption spectroscopy.Through the verification of the detection method for technical indicators such as standard curve,recovery rate,precision,and detection limit,the results showed that the linear relationship of the standard curve was good,with a correlation coefficient greater than 0.99.The recovery rate of the added standard was 90%~100.5%,the RSD of precision was between 1.2%~6.7%,and the detection limit was 0.2 mg/kg.The results all met the requirements,indicating the feasibility of the method.Elaborate on how to conduct method validation for a new project during its establishment,which has strong practicality and guidance.
